虚拟现实(Virtual Reality,简称VR)作为一种革命性的技术,正深刻地改变着我们的生活方式和工作模式。而虚拟现实头盔作为实现这一变革的关键设备之一,不仅为用户提供了前所未有的沉浸感体验,还成为了教育、娱乐乃至医疗等多个领域的重要工具。
# 1. 虚拟现实头盔的构成与工作原理
虚拟现实头盔通常由硬件和软件两大部分组成。硬件部分主要包括头显、传感器、显示器及控制器等;而软件则涵盖开发平台、渲染引擎以及交互系统。其中,头显是用户直接接触的部分,它通过内置的高清显示屏向佩戴者的眼睛提供高分辨率图像,从而构建出三维虚拟环境;传感器用于跟踪用户的头部运动,并将这些数据实时传输给系统进行处理与更新画面;控制器则是用户与虚拟世界互动的主要工具。
# 2. 虚拟现实头盔的应用场景
虚拟现实技术具有广泛的应用前景,在教育、娱乐、医疗等多个领域均有巨大潜力。在教育方面,VR可以模拟历史事件或科学现象,使学生能够以更直观的方式学习知识;在娱乐产业中,VR游戏和电影为用户带来身临其境的体验;而在医学培训上,医生可以通过虚拟手术来练习复杂操作。
# 3. 分布式数据库:构建高效稳定的云计算基础
分布式数据库作为现代信息技术不可或缺的一部分,在企业级应用中扮演着举足轻重的角色。与传统的集中式数据库不同,它通过将数据分布在多个节点上来提高系统性能和可用性,并确保了数据的一致性和安全性。
# 4. 分布式数据库的工作原理及特点
分布式数据库是基于多台计算机相互协作来共同完成任务的一种架构模式。每个节点都拥有部分或全部的数据副本,在接收到查询请求后,根据预设规则进行处理并返回结果给客户端。这种设计使得数据能够被灵活地存储在不同地理位置上的服务器中,从而提高了整体系统的可靠性和扩展性。
# 5. 分布式数据库的关键技术
分布式数据库涉及多种关键技术,主要包括一致性模型、复制与容错机制以及查询优化算法等。一致性模型确保了所有节点之间的数据同步;而复制与容错机制则通过在多个节点间维护冗余副本以防止单点故障的发生;最后,在执行复杂查询时,需要利用合适的优化策略来提高性能。
# 6. 虚拟现实头盔与分布式数据库的结合
将虚拟现实技术与分布式数据库相结合可以为用户提供更加丰富和真实的体验。例如,在大型多人在线游戏(MMOG)中,通过在云服务器上运行高度复杂的模拟环境,并使用分布式数据库管理角色状态信息及物品记录,便能够实现大规模玩家群体之间的实时互动。此外,利用VR设备访问这些云端构建的虚拟世界还能够让用户享受到超越传统网络连接速度限制带来的流畅体验。
# 7. 发展趋势与未来展望
随着5G、物联网等新兴技术的发展,虚拟现实头盔和分布式数据库将迎来更加广阔的应用场景。一方面,更高分辨率、更低延迟的新一代显示设备将提供更逼真沉浸式的视觉效果;另一方面,在边缘计算的支持下,更多的实时数据处理任务也可以在网络边缘完成,从而进一步减轻中心服务器的压力。
# 8. 结语
虚拟现实头盔与分布式数据库作为当今科技领域的两个重要分支,正逐渐渗透到我们生活的各个方面。它们不仅能够带来前所未有的创新体验,还能推动各个行业向着更加智能化、高效化方向发展。未来,随着技术的进步和应用的不断拓展,这两项技术有望成为构建下一代数字生态系统不可或缺的核心组成部分。
虚拟现实头盔与分布式数据库:技术融合与创新
虚拟现实(Virtual Reality, VR)作为一种沉浸式体验技术,在当今科技世界中占据着举足轻重的地位。它通过模拟真实的视觉、听觉甚至触觉感受,让用户仿佛置身于一个完全虚构的三维空间之中;而分布式数据库则是另一种重要的信息技术工具,其核心功能是将数据分布在多个节点上来提高系统性能和可用性,确保了数据的一致性和安全性。本文旨在探讨这两项技术如何结合在一起,并展望它们在未来的应用前景。
# 1. 虚拟现实头盔的定义及关键技术
虚拟现实头盔是一种能够模拟现实环境或创造全新场景的设备。其主要组成部分包括高清显示屏、传感器以及跟踪系统等硬件,以及开发平台、渲染引擎和交互系统的软件支持。通过这些组件协同工作,用户可以以第一人称视角体验到高度逼真的虚拟世界。
# 2. 虚拟现实头盔在教育领域的应用
教育行业是虚拟现实技术最广泛的应用场景之一。借助VR设备,教师能够为学生创建沉浸式的学习环境,从而提高他们的参与度和理解力。例如,在历史课程中,学生可以通过戴上VR眼镜“亲身”参观古代遗址或博物馆;而生物学爱好者则能在微观世界中观察细胞结构的动态变化过程。
# 3. 虚拟现实头盔在娱乐行业的应用
虚拟现实技术不仅为传统游戏提供了全新的交互方式,还催生了诸多创新的游戏类型。比如多人在线战斗竞技场(MMORPG)或角色扮演游戏(RPG),其中玩家可以与其他真人玩家实时互动,共同完成任务或者进行激烈对抗。
# 4. 虚拟现实在医疗领域的应用
虚拟现实技术为医学领域带来了一系列革新性的变革。通过模拟复杂的手术场景,医生可以在安全的环境中练习各种高风险操作;同时,在心理治疗中,VR也能帮助患者克服恐惧障碍或其他精神疾病。
# 5. 分布式数据库的基本概念与优势
分布式数据库是将数据分布在多台计算机上的一种方法,以提供更高的可用性和性能。它的主要特点包括:横向扩展能力、可靠性以及跨地域的数据访问等。这些特性使得分布式数据库特别适合处理大规模的并发请求和海量存储需求。
# 6. 分布式数据库的关键技术
要实现高效稳定的分布式数据库系统,需要掌握一系列核心技术,主要包括:一致性模型、复制与容错机制以及查询优化算法等。其中,一致性模型确保了不同节点之间数据的一致性;而复制与容错机制则通过在多个节点上维护冗余副本来提高系统的可靠性和可用性。
# 7. 虚拟现实头盔和分布式数据库的融合应用
随着技术的进步,虚拟现实头盔与分布式数据库开始展现出更多的协同效应。例如,在大型在线游戏中,利用VR设备访问云端构建的虚拟世界可以提供更加流畅、真实的体验;而在教育领域,则可以通过云平台分享优质教育资源,并将数据存储在多个节点上以保证系统的稳定运行。
# 8. 案例分析:Facebook Horizon Meta
近年来,Meta(前身为Facebook)推出了一款名为Horizon Workrooms的虚拟现实协作平台。该产品结合了VR头盔和分布式数据库技术,在实际工作中取得了显著成效。通过在云端创建共享的工作空间并实时同步多个用户的输入操作,用户可以与其他同事进行无缝沟通与合作。
# 9. 发展趋势与未来展望
随着5G网络、边缘计算等新技术的发展,虚拟现实头盔与分布式数据库的应用前景将更加广阔。一方面,更高的分辨率和更低的延迟要求将进一步推动硬件设备的进步;另一方面,更多的实时数据处理任务可以在网络边缘完成,从而减轻中心服务器的压力。
# 10. 结语
虚拟现实头盔与分布式数据库作为当今科技领域的两个重要分支,在教育、娱乐及医疗等多个领域展现出巨大的应用潜力。随着技术不断进步和应用场景的日益丰富,这两项技术有望成为构建下一代数字生态系统不可或缺的核心组成部分。